Re:overheating when crusing.. please help
just do a compression test if you think it's the head gasket. i just replaced the radiator fan switch temp sensor cause my car would overheat after a while. the fans would come on when the car was in idle parked, but when the car got hot, the fan switch would stop working. no problems for 1 week now with the new fan switch sensor. i did a compression test and it was good. before that evyone would say headgasket, pistons, rings.lol did you install the thermostat backwards? just a thought. and i'd change the fan switch sensor if you've never done that.
